12. Troubleshooting
Marker double firing or going full auto • Air cylinder low on air • Get air cylinder filled
• Rear bolt O-ring worn or damaged • Replace rear bolt O-ring
• Rear bolt or sear worn • Inspect both for wear and replace if needed
• Rear bolt has no oil • Oil rear bolt O-ring area with paintball oil
• Bad valve • Service or replace valve
Marker does not re-cock • Rear bolt O-ring worn or damaged • Replace rear bolt O-ring
• Rear bolt O-ring is dry • Oil rear bolt O-ring area with paintball oil
• Power tube is damaged • Replace power tube
• Marker internals clogged • Clean dirt and/or broken paintballs from inside receiver and barrel
Gas leaking out of barrel • Valve leaking • Service or replace valve
Gas leaking at ASA • Tank O-ring damaged or missing • Replace tank O-ring
• Tank or ASA damaged • Replace tank and/or ASA if needed
Marker is breaking paint • Velocity is too high • Lower velocity by turning screw clockwise
• Paint is of low quality or old • Try better fresh paint
• Ball detent damaged or backwards • Replace detent or check if it’s in backwards
Marker is double feeding • Ball detent is damaged • Replace ball detent
Velocity is low (Do NOT Exceed 300 FPS) • Velocity screw is in too far • Turn the screw counter-clockwise to increase velocity
• Air source is low • Get air cylinder filled
• Power tube is damaged • Replace power tube
• Drive spring is weak • Install a stiffer drive spring
Velocity is high (Do NOT Exceed 300 FPS) • Velocity screw is out too far • Lower velocity by turning screw clockwise
• Drive spring is too stiff • Install a lighter drive spring
